OTTAWA (Reuters) – Canada added some 952,900 jobs in June, mostly in the service sector, Statistics Canada said on Friday. The jobless rate improved to 12.3%.
Employment in the goods producing sector rose by 158,600. The services sector gained some 794,400 positions.
